A Life of Grace: Honoring a Royal Figure’s Lasting Legacy

The British royal family recently marked a quiet period of reflection following the passing of Katharine, Duchess of Kent, a respected senior figure known for her grace and discretion.

She lived a life defined by service and compassion, largely stepping away from public attention in later years while still leaving a meaningful impact through her earlier work.

Despite her preference for privacy, her contributions continued to resonate, particularly through her involvement in charitable efforts and community initiatives.

Throughout her life, she supported causes such as education, music, and social programs, often working closely with organizations that focused on helping others.

Those who knew her described her as thoughtful and kind, someone who valued sincerity over recognition and preferred to lead through quiet actions rather than public visibility.

In her later years, she chose a more private and simple lifestyle, earning admiration for staying true to her values and focusing on personal relationships and inner peace.

She will be remembered for her dignity and dedication, with a legacy shaped not just by her title, but by the lasting influence she had on people and communities.
